  2. I installed my 35W 6000K HID kit for my low beans the other day on my 2015 Silverado 1500 High Country. I'm currently having some issues with the DRLs and was wondering if anyone has seen anything similar? If I turn the truck on with the lights on auto and put it into drive the DRLs will not turn on. If I'm in park and turn the lights all the way on, then back to auto, then put it into drive the DRLs will stay on. Anyone know why this is happening and what I can do to fix it? Question for people with a 2-2.5" level kit -> I'm looking to install the 2.25" Ready Lift Kit in the front and the 1" block kit in the rear and was wondering if 33's would have any rubbing issues with the OEM Chevy moulded mud flaps? Don't really want to install them and then have to remove them later because they require drilling. Any help would be great. Jason
